Affordable Indoor Halloween Decor Ideas

1. Mason Jar Lanterns

First, turn mason jars into glowing lanterns with orange paint, black markers, and battery-operated candles. These jars also work as cute Halloween decorations for shelves, tables, or windows. In addition, you can draw jack-o’-lantern faces, ghosts, or bats for variety.

2. Spooky Silhouettes

Cut out black paper shapes—cats, witches, spiders—and tape them to your windows. When lights shine through, you’ll have scary Halloween decorations without spending more than a few dollars.

3. DIY Haunted House Corners

First, transform a small area of your home into a spooky scene. Next, use old sheets as cobwebs, and then hang bats made from cardboard or even wrapping paper. In addition, scatter fake spiders around to complete the look. As a result, this becomes a quick way to create DIY haunted house decor that truly impresses guests.

4. DIY Halloween Garland

Create your own cute and spooky Halloween garland using just a few materials. You’ll need 1 inch felt balls of your choosing, felt ghosts or bats, twine, and a felting needle. Tie your twine to your felting needling just like you would for sewing and gently thread through the felt balls and ghosts. Viola! You’ve created a cute and not so scary garland to hang in any space of your home.

Budget-Friendly Outdoor Halloween Crafts

1. Ghostly Yard Figures

White sheets draped over sticks or tomato cages can instantly turn your yard into a ghostly graveyard. In addition, you can add glow sticks inside for a chilling nighttime effect; therefore, it becomes a perfect outdoor Halloween craft on a budget.

2. Jack-o’-Lantern Alternatives

Instead of carving pumpkins, paint them. Use bold colors, glitter, temporary tattoos or glow-in-the-dark paint. These pumpkins last longer and double as festive Halloween crafts that even kids can help with.

3. Halloween Porch Decor

Greet trick-or-treaters with a spooky entryway. To begin, place a doormat painted with bats. Next, string up orange fairy lights, and then hang a DIY wreath made from black ribbon and faux cobwebs. In addition, this Halloween porch decor makes a bold statement while still staying budget-friendly.

Quick and Easy Halloween Crafts for Last-Minute Decorating

Not everyone has time for hours of crafting. Fortunately, these quick Halloween crafts can add festive flair in minutes:

First, paper bats: Cut bat shapes from black cardstock and stick them on walls for a flying effect.

Next, spooky candles: Wrap toilet paper around glass candles to make mummy lanterns.

Finally, pumpkin balloons: Draw jack-o’-lantern faces on orange balloons for instant, cheap Halloween decor.

Overall, these simple Halloween DIY crafts are perfect for busy families or party hosts who need fast, affordable solutions.


Creative Halloween Party Decorations

Planning a Halloween party? DIY decorations will save money and wow your guests. Here are a few ideas:

  • Creepy table setup: Cover tables with black cloths, add plastic spiders, and serve snacks in cauldrons.
  • Potion bottles: Repurpose glass bottles, fill them with colored water, and label them with names like “Witch’s Brew” or “Zombie Blood.”
  • Hanging ghosts: Use white balloons and tissue paper to make floating ghosts for DIY spooky decor.

With these touches, your party will look straight out of a haunted mansion while staying within budget.


Tips for Affordable Spooky Decor

If you want affordable spooky decor without sacrificing style, keep these Halloween decorating tips in mind:

  • Reuse materials from previous holidays (like string lights or mason jars).
  • Shop dollar stores for budget-friendly supplies.
  • Stick to a theme—scary, cute, or elegant—so your decorations feel cohesive.
  • Mix homemade and store-bought pieces for balance.

By following these tips, you can enjoy homemade Halloween ideas that are cost-effective and stylish.
